Programming the Universe: A Quantum Computer Scientist Takes on Cosmos

Bol The legendary computer science guru compares the universe to a giant quantum computer, arguing that all interactions between particles in the universe convey information as well as energy, a theory that he uses to trace the history and workings of the universe, from the Big Bang to the present day.
